    A wonderful iris !!! Please tell me how exactly do you take blue, red, yellow? cobalt or blue, kraplak or carmine, cadmium yellow or cadmium lemon?

    • @scorbett4370
      @scorbett4370 Год назад

      To substitute Yong’s Winsor Newton watercolor paints use their pigment code and name as follows: Winsor Red (PR254 Pyrrol Red), Winsor Yellow (PY154 Benzimidazolone Yellow), Winsor Blue RS (PB15 Phthalo Blue RS), Winsor Blue GS (PB 15-3 Phthalo Blue GS), and Winsor Violet (PV23 Dioxazine Violet).
